520 3 _aInvestigates the apparently growing trend towards the fragmentation of states, as smaller groups seek greater autonomy based on their own culture, language, or tradition. Suggests that the dislocation and violence often associated with realising these ambitions places a responsibility on the international community to require compliance with certain standards before granting support or recognition.
